Commercial Slab Installation in Fargo, ND
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ete slabs that serve as the foundation for various types of structures, including warehouses, retail spaces, garages, and parking lots. These projects typically require a level, durable surface that can support heavy equipment, foot traffic, or vehicular loads. Property owners often seek this service to ensure a stable base for new construction or to replace existing slabs that have cracked or settled over time, helping to maintain the safety and functionality of the property.
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the area, soil conditions, and drainage needs. Understanding the intended use of the slab can influence decisions about thickness, reinforcement, and finishing. Proper planning and preparation are essential to achieve a long-lasting result that meets the specific demands of the project, making it important to discuss these details with a professional contractor experienced in commercial concrete work.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require a concrete slab? Concrete slabs are commonly used for foundations, driveways, patios, and garage floors in residential and commercial properties.
How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ness depends on the intended use, but typical slabs range from 4 to 6 inches for standard applications.
What preparation is needed before slab installation? The site should be properly leveled, and the ground should be compacted to ensure stability and prevent cracking.
Are there specific considerations for outdoor slabs? Outdoor slabs should include proper drainage, reinforcement, and control joints to manage expansion and contraction.
